## Tuning the Replica Lag Alarm

The `laghound` alarm watches read-replica lag on the Corvalle cluster and pages when sustained lag exceeds threshold for a full evaluation window. Short spikes during nightly compaction are expected and should not page; the window and hysteresis values exist to suppress them. If the team agrees at the weekly sync to change sensitivity, update the config and note the rationale in the changelog. For discussion, the current constants are reproduced here.

constants for kageg-bawif:
QUOTAS = {
    "quenwyn": 1,
    "oliix": 10,
}

**Ticket: Telemetry gateway drift, staging vs prod**

Reviewer: the Furrowline farm-equipment telemetry gateway has drifted. Staging was hand-edited during the harvest-season incident and never reconciled. Symptoms: duplicate sensor readings and a retry storm against the Haybern ingest queue. Prod values are canonical; staging must match. Diff is small but the retry and buffer settings matter. Please verify the replacement file line by line against the following.

config for haweg-bagag:
[kasath]
host = kasath.qirvancorp.internal
user = kasath_svc
database = kasath_prod

Subject: Responsibility change — Larchview Clinic reminder job. Effective immediately, the nightly appointment reminder job moves off the shared Ostrel scheduler onto its own service account with scoped credentials. SMS payload templating was audited last sprint; no patient identifiers beyond first name and time slot are included. The retry queue now purges after 48 hours instead of persisting indefinitely. All future security questions, access requests, and audit queries for this job go to:

approver of bagug-bagag = Holael Pramir